Average Cost to Build an Air Taxi Booking Platform

The cost of building an air taxi booking system depends on the complexity of the platform, number of features, integrations with aviation systems, and scalability requirements.

Most startups launch their platforms in phases, starting with an MVP (Minimum Viable Product) and gradually expanding features.

Platform Type Estimated Development Cost Description
MVP Air Taxi Platform $40,000 – $60,000 Basic passenger booking app, pilot app, and admin panel
Commercial Launch Platform $80,000 – $150,000 Advanced dispatch, fleet monitoring, payment integration, and analytics
Enterprise Multi-City Platform $200,000+ Large-scale infrastructure with AI optimization and global scalability

Why Air Taxi Platforms Are More Expensive Than Ride-Hailing Apps

Traditional ride-hailing apps like Uber or Bolt primarily manage ground transportation. In contrast, air taxi platforms must integrate aviation-specific systems that handle aircraft scheduling, regulatory compliance, and flight safety.

While a standard taxi booking application can cost between $8,000 and $55,000 depending on features and complexity, air taxi platforms require additional aviation infrastructure and compliance modules. :contentReference[oaicite:1]{index=1}

These additional requirements increase development complexity and cost.


Core Components of an Air Taxi Booking Platform

A typical air taxi platform consists of multiple applications and backend systems that work together to manage flight operations.

Component Purpose
Passenger Mobile App Allows users to search routes, schedule flights, and book air taxi rides
Pilot Mobile App Provides pilots with flight assignments and operational updates
Flight Dispatch System Manages aircraft scheduling and route optimization
Fleet Management Software Tracks aircraft performance, maintenance, and availability
Admin Dashboard Centralized system for managing bookings, users, payments, and analytics
Payment Infrastructure Handles secure transactions and billing

Technology Stack Used for Air Taxi Platforms

Modern air taxi systems are built using scalable cloud infrastructure and modular microservices architecture.

Layer Technology
Mobile Apps Flutter, React Native, Swift, Kotlin
Backend Systems Node.js, Laravel, or microservices architecture
Real-Time Communication WebSockets and event streaming systems
Cloud Infrastructure AWS, Microsoft Azure, or Google Cloud
AI and Analytics Demand forecasting and route optimization algorithms

How long does it take to develop an air taxi platform?

An MVP can take 3–6 months, while enterprise-level platforms may require 6–12 months depending on complexity.
